2:00 PM - 4:00 PM Artist Reception: Constellating Narratives - Cynthia Brannvall
FLEX # 34.xx
Cynthia Branvall is an artist and art historian visiting from Foothill College. She weaves together an investigative curiosity and familiarity with the archives into an art practice that defies the limitations of a singular medium.  Brannvall was a Foothill College student, before receiving two Bachelors degrees (Practice of Art and History of Art) from University of California, Berkeley. Her MA was earned at CSU, San Francisco.  Amidst a busy teaching schedule of Art History courses, Brannvall is prolific, making new series and exhibiting throughout the state.  Notable residencies and awards include the Cubberley Artist Studio Program which is a 4 year artist studio residency and the Artistic Achievement Award, “Art of the African Diaspora” Richmond Art Center. She has also been featured in a solo exhibition at MoAD (Museum of African Diaspora) in San Francisco.  "I hope my artwork creates a soft landing and a place where we can meet and engage with the complexities of identity, different perspectives and the contradictions that are American identity and experience." -Cynthia Brannvall.  Her haunting and varied series explore race, history, family, gender, sexuality, industry, landscape, and spirituality. They are correlating constellations in her personal universe, that will draw you into their orbit.

1:00 PM - 3:00 PM Board of Trustees Meeting
The Butte-Glenn Community College District is governed by its seven-member, locally elected Board of Trustees and a student board member. The board is responsible for the educational, physical, and financial well-being of the district.

The Board of Trustees holds a regular public meeting once a month during the academic year. Regular board meetings convene at 1 p.m. in the Board Room, Student Administrative Services building (SAS 360), 3536 Butte Campus Drive, Oroville, CA 95965, unless otherwise posted.

Agenda’s containing a brief description of each item of business is posted at the district office and on the district’s website 72 hours before regular meetings and 24 hours before a special meeting. The current board meeting agenda and archived agendas are viewable at on our website.

11:00 AM - 12:00 PM QPR - Suicide Prevention Training
FLEX # 515.1
QPR stands for Question, Persuade, and Refer — the 3 simple steps anyone can learn to help save a life from suicide. QPR stands for Question, Persuade & Refer and is an evidence-based training.

The QPR mission is to reduce suicidal behaviors and save lives by providing innovative, practical and proven suicide prevention training. The signs of crisis are all around us. Quality education surrounding suicide prevention and intervention empowers all people to make a positive difference in the life of someone they know.

Just as people trained in CPR and the Heimlich Maneuver help save thousands of lives each year, people trained in QPR learn how to recognize the warning signs of a suicide crisis and how to question, persuade, and refer someone to help. Each year thousands of Americans, like you, are saying "Yes" to saving the life of a friend, colleague, sibling, or neighbor.

QPR can be learned in the Gatekeeper course in as little as one hour.

12:00 PM - 3:00 PM All Its Name Implies: Film Screening & Director Q & A
FLEX # 34.99
This film is a recent documentary about the 2018 Camp Fire. It will be shown this Friday September 22 2023, in the Black Box Theater on the Main Campus from 12pm -3pm. Following the screening there will be a discussion with questions and answers with the Emmy-award winning filmmaker Ev Duran. This event is free and open to the public.
